01
Goal and starting point
We first understand the company, its customers, its offer and the reason for change. You can come to us with just an idea or with a website that is not delivering the expected results.
Deliverable: an agreed goal and priorities -
02
Recommended scope
We propose what should be included in the first phase and what can wait. We explain the options and how they affect the price, timeline and future maintenance.
Deliverable: a specific scope with no unnecessary items -
03
Quote and timeline
Before work begins, you receive a clear price, process, timeline and list of required materials. For larger projects, we divide delivery into clear phases.
Deliverable: a proposal you can make a decision on -
04
Structure, copy and visual direction
We plan the visitor journey, page hierarchy, core message and visual design. Every part must help people understand the offer and take the next step.
Deliverable: an approved content and visual foundation -
05
Development, content and testing
We build the responsive website or e-commerce store, add content, an SEO foundation, tracking and key integrations. Before launch, we test the mobile experience, forms, speed and indexability.
Deliverable: a tested solution ready to launch -
06
Launch and ongoing development
After launch, we verify key actions and the technical state. Depending on the project, we can continue with SEO, campaigns, content, maintenance or new features.
Deliverable: a working website and a clear list of further opportunities

Cooperation FAQ
A sound process saves time and budget. That is why we explain in advance what we will prepare and where we need your decision.
What happens after sending an inquiry?
We review your brief, clarify the goal, customers, scope and materials, then prepare a proposal with recommended steps.
How long does website or campaign preparation take?
It depends on scope, materials and approval speed. A smaller landing page can be quick; larger projects need more preparation.
Will we understand what is being done?
Yes. We explain decisions in plain language and connect technology to business goals.
What if we do not have copy, photos or structure yet?
That is common. We can help plan structure, write copy, prepare questions and recommend visual materials.
